|  John Maguire | d4a7df3083
							
							Rename pki.default_version to pki.initiating_version (#1381) | 6 months ago | 
				
					
						|  Nate Brown | d97ed57a19
							
							V2 certificate format (#1216) | 7 months ago | 
				
					
						|  Nate Brown | 08ac65362e
							
							Cert interface (#1212) | 1 year ago | 
				
					
						|  Nate Brown | e264a0ff88
							
							Switch most everything to netip in prep for ipv6 in the overlay (#1173) | 1 year ago | 
				
					
						|  Ben Ritcey | 01cddb8013
							
							Added firewall.rules.hash metric (#1010) | 1 year ago | 
				
					
						|  Nate Brown | 3356e03d85
							
							Default `pki.disconnect_invalid` to true and make it reloadable (#859) | 1 year ago | 
				
					
						|  Nate Brown | 5a131b2975
							
							Combine ca, cert, and key handling (#952) | 2 years ago | 
				
					
						|  Nate Brown | 223cc6e660
							
							Limit how often a busy tunnel can requery the lighthouse (#940) | 2 years ago | 
				
					
						|  Nate Brown | a3e59a38ef
							
							Use registered io on Windows when possible (#905) | 2 years ago | 
				
					
						|  Nate Brown | 3bbf5f4e67
							
							Use an interface for udp conns (#901) | 2 years ago | 
				
					
						|  Nate Brown | 03e4a7f988
							
							Rehandshaking (#838) | 2 years ago | 
				
					
						|  Wade Simmons | 0b67b19771
							
							add boringcrypto Makefile targets (#856) | 2 years ago | 
				
					
						|  brad-defined | 9b03053191
							
							update EncReader and EncWriter interface function args to have concrete types (#844) | 2 years ago | 
				
					
						|  Wade Simmons | 6685856b5d
							
							emit certificate.expiration_ttl_seconds metric (#782) | 2 years ago | 
				
					
						|  Nate Brown | ee8e1348e9
							
							Use connection manager to drive NAT maintenance (#835) | 2 years ago | 
				
					
						|  Nate Brown | 6b3d42efa5
							
							Use atomic.Pointer for certState (#833) | 2 years ago | 
				
					
						|  Wade Simmons | 9af242dc47
							
							switch to new sync/atomic helpers in go1.19 (#728) | 3 years ago | 
				
					
						|  Wade Simmons | 7b9287709c
							
							add listen.send_recv_error config option (#670) | 3 years ago | 
				
					
						|  brad-defined | 1a7c575011
							
							Relay (#678) | 3 years ago | 
				
					
						|  Nate Brown | 78d0d46bae
							
							Remove WriteRaw, cidrTree -> routeTree to better describe its purpose, remove redundancy from field names (#582) | 4 years ago | 
				
					
						|  Nate Brown | 88ce0edf76
							
							Start the overlay package with the old Inside interface (#576) | 4 years ago | 
				
					
						|  CzBiX | 16be0ce566
							
							Add Wintun support (#289) | 4 years ago | 
				
					
						|  Nate Brown | bcabcfdaca
							
							Rework some things into packages (#489) | 4 years ago | 
				
					
						|  brad-defined | 6ae8ba26f7
							
							Add a context object in nebula.Main to clean up on error (#550) | 4 years ago | 
				
					
						|  Donatas Abraitis | 32e2619323
							
							Teardown tunnel automatically if peer's certificate expired (#370) | 4 years ago | 
				
					
						|  Wade Simmons | 44cb697552
							
							Add more metrics (#450) | 4 years ago | 
				
					
						|  brad-defined | 17106f83a0
							
							Ensure the Nebula device exists before attempting to bind to the Nebula IP (#375) | 4 years ago | 
				
					
						|  Nathan Brown | 64d8e5aa96
							
							More LH cleanup (#429) | 4 years ago | 
				
					
						|  Nathan Brown | 883e09a392
							
							Don't use a global ca pool (#426) | 4 years ago | 
				
					
						|  Nathan Brown | 3ea7e1b75f
							
							Don't use a global logger (#423) | 4 years ago |